ADU Rules
What can you build in Stow, OH?
Stow, OH follows state and local rules for Accessory Dwelling Units. Here is a concise overview of the local rules.
Eligibility
- –Internal / Attached ADU: Not addressed in the local bylaw
- –Detached ADU: Not addressed in the local bylaw
Parking
- –No explicit ADU parking min/max; for uses not specified, apply the standard for a similar use; parking for dwelling units must be on the same lot.
